Hylopsar

Hylopsar is a genus of African birds in the family Sturnidae.

Species

ImageScientific nameCommon NameDistribution
Hylopsar purpureicepsPurple-headed starlingAngola, Benin, Cameroon, Central African Republic, Republic of the Congo, Democratic Republic of the Congo, Ivory Coast, Equatorial Guinea, Gabon, Guinea, Nigeria, and Uganda.
Hylopsar cupreocaudaCopper-tailed starlingIvory Coast, Ghana, Guinea, Liberia, and Sierra Leone
